Position Summary

The MDS Nurse (MDS) cares  for people who are sick, injured, convalescent or disabled.  They participate in the planning, implementation,  evaluation of resident nursing care and are responsible for gathering Minimum Data Set (MDS) based on the objectives, standards, and policies of the facility.  MDS  Nurse works  under the direction of the Director of Nursing ; the nature of the direction and supervision required varies by job setting.

 

Position Responsibilities

MDS Nurses are responsible for collecting integral data and compiling it into a thorough report for further research at their facility.  Common responsibilities of MDS Nurse include (but are not limited to): 

  • Promotes and maintains a focus of patient-centered care
  • Adheres to laws, rules & regulations and practices ethical integrity and interpersonal skills
  • Maintains compliance with long-term care regulations including federal, state and health regulations
  • Participate in the admission process of prospective residents in terms of their nursing needs and appropriate placement
  • Assesses the resident and gather relevant information from multiple sources including: a. Observation
  • Physical assessment
  • Symptom or condition-related assessments (Braden, AIMS, falls, et)
  • Resident and family interviews
  • Hospital discharge summaries
  • Consultant reports
  • Lab and diagnostic test results
  • Evaluations from other disciplines (for example: dietary, respiratory, social services, etc.)
  • Determines potential PDPM and expense associated with a potential admission
  • Completes and assures the accuracy of the MDS process for all residents (per the RAI Manual schedule)
  • Submits the completed MDS per the RAI Manual schedule
  • Post MDS submission when accepted and correct incorrect MDS and resubmit correctly
  • Monitor Case Mix Index scores, looking for potential risks and/or changes that may affect Medicaid reimbursement
  • Monitors Medicare assessment schedules and nursing documentation to ensure accuracy and timely submission 12. Develops and distributes MDS calendar
  • Upload MDS to Abaqis system and enter ER visits into the Abaqis system
  • Maintains comfortable, orderly, safe and clean environment for patients
  • Records all care information concisely, accurately and completely, in a timely manner in the appropriate computer system, format and on the appropriate forms
  • Performs position duties in a manner as to assure resident safety and rights are priority
  • Adheres to the facility corporate compliance program and promotes the program in a positive and effective manner
  • Performs other position-related duties as assigned, depending on assignment/shift setting

Working Conditions

Because the patients need round-the clock care, working hours include days, nights, weekends and holidays.  The number of patients assigned per shift will vary with facility and specialty, if applicable.  MDS Nurses must guard against back injury because they may have to assist CNA's in patient lifts and transfers; they must follow proper company procedures as it relates to the use of mechanical patient lift devices .  Employees are encouraged to safely move patients requesting assistance to roll/lift/transfer patients.  MDS Nurses may face hazards from exposure to chemicals and infectious diseases.  In addition, the population cared for will contain patients that are confused, irrational, agitated, and/or uncooperative.

 

Physical Demands

  • Prolonged periods of standing, bending, and reaching
  • Ability to lift fifty (50) pounds.  Moving, lifting or transferring of patients may involve lifting of up to one- hundred (100) pounds
  • Fine motor skills
  • Visual acuity

The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of the job.  While performing the duties of this job, the employee is regularly required to stand and talk or hear.  The employee is frequently required to walk; use hands to finger, handle, or feel; and reach forward with hands and arms.  The employee is occasionally required to sit and stoop, kneel, or crouch.  The employee must frequently lift and/or move up to 50 pounds and may lift and/or move 100 pounds.  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ision, distance vision, color vision, peripheral vision, depth perception, and ability to adjust focus.  

Physical Demand Ratings are an estimate of the overall strength requirements that are consider to be important for an average, successful work performance of a specific job. The overall physical demand rating for an MDS Nurse falls within the Medium classification.  However, due to the resident population, this position has been classified as Heavy (exerting 50 to 100 pounds of force occasionally, and/or 20 to 50 pounds of force frequently, and/or 10 to 20 pounds of force constantly to move objects).  Physical Demand requirements are in excess of those for Light Work.
